Wisebot X3 Upper Limb Rehabilitation Robot
The Wisebot X3 from Huaquejing Medical delivers 3D upper limb rehabilitation training through an intelligent platform designed for patients with motor dysfunction. As part of the Wisebot product family, it shares the company’s core rehabilitation technology architecture while providing configuration options suited to different clinical settings.
Product Overview
Built on Huaquejing Medical’s proprietary rehabilitation robot technology stack, the Wisebot X3 offers broad upper limb assessment and training capabilities. The system incorporates the company’s unified software-hardware architecture, robot control algorithms, and human-machine interaction technologies developed through collaboration with rehabilitation medicine experts.
The X3 targets patients requiring systematic upper limb rehabilitation, providing structured training protocols across recovery stages with objective assessment data to guide therapy progression.
Key Features
3D Movement Training: Multi-plane upper limb movement training that follows anatomical joint patterns.
Multiple Training Modes: Configurable active, passive, and combined training protocols to match patient capabilities.
Assessment Integration: Built-in evaluation tools measure patient progress and functional recovery.
VR-Compatible Platform: Designed to integrate with virtual reality rehabilitation content for enhanced patient engagement.
Technical Specifications
For stroke rehabilitation, Huaquejing Medical’s Wisebot X3 provides 3D multi-plane upper limb training with active, passive, and combined protocols under NMPA-approved Class II certification.
| Parameter | Specification |
|---|---|
| Robot Type | Upper limb training system |
| Movement Dimensions | 3D (multi-plane) |
| Training Modes | Active, Passive, Active-Passive |
| Assessment | Integrated evaluation protocols |
| Classification | Class II Medical Device |
Clinical Applications
The Wisebot X3 addresses upper limb rehabilitation needs for:
- Stroke survivors with arm and shoulder dysfunction
- Patients recovering from neurological injury
- Individuals requiring motor relearning therapy
The system supports therapists in delivering consistent, measurable rehabilitation sessions while reducing the physical demands of manual therapy provision.
Regulatory Status
| Region | Status | Date |
|---|---|---|
| China (NMPA) | Approved | 2022 |
| Europe (CE) | Not Applied | - |
| USA (FDA) | Not Applied | - |
Frequently Asked Questions
How does the Wisebot X3 differ from the X5 model?
While both systems provide 3D upper limb rehabilitation, the X5 includes advanced mirror training capability with Brunnstrom intelligent assessment and deep learning-based training plan generation. The X3 offers core upper limb rehabilitation functions in a configuration suited to facilities seeking essential robotic rehabilitation capability.
What clinical settings use the Wisebot X3?
The system serves hospital rehabilitation departments, specialized rehabilitation centers, and community healthcare facilities providing upper limb motor rehabilitation services.
Can the Wisebot X3 track patient progress over time?
The integrated assessment functions enable therapists to measure and document functional improvements across treatment sessions.
